5 Simple Steps Retailers Can Take to Build Stronger Relationships with Customers

InMoment XI

Many studies show that repeat customers are likely to purchase more frequently, spend more money, and pay a premium for a product. In addition to generating more income from their own purchases, loyal customers are more likely to refer new customers to the brand, furthering the cycle of customer retention.
